Suppose a random sample of 50 college students are asked to measure the length of their right foot in centimeters. A 95% confide

nce interval for the mean foot length for students at the college is found to be 21.709 to 25.091 cm. If a 99% confidence interval were calculated instead, how would it differ from the 95% confidence interval

Answer:

A  99% confidence interval  will be wider than a 95% confidence interval

Step-by-step explanation:

From the question we are told that

  The  95% confidence interval for for the mean foot length for students at the college is found to be 21.709 to 25.091 cm

Generally the width of a confidence interval is dependent on the margin of error.

Generally the margin of error is mathematically represented as  

     E =  Z_{\frac{\alpha }{2} } * \sqrt{\frac{\^ p (1- \^ p)}{n} }

From the above equation we see that

          E \ \  \alpha \ \   Z_{\frac{\alpha }{2} }

Here  Z_{\frac{\alpha }{2} }  is the critical value of the half of the level of significance and this value  increase as the confidence level increase

Now if a  99% confidence level is  used , it then means that the value of  

 Z_{\frac{\alpha }{2} }  will increase, this in turn will increase  the margin of error and in turn this will increase the width of the confidence interval

Hence a 99% confidence interval  will be wider than a 95% confidence interval
